Airborne Lasers

ALMDS (Airborne Laser Mine Detection System) – Used for the detection and localization of surface and near-surface mines; platform is the MH-60S helicopter; 45 W average power of 532nm at 350 Hz, 10 ns pulsewidth; fully qualified against MIL-STD-810F, MIL-STD-704E, and MIL-STD-461E in both storage and operational scenarios; input power is three-phase, 400 Hz, 115 VAC

RAMICS (Rapid Airborne Mine Clearance Systems) – Used for the reacquisition and neutralization of mines located by ALMDS; platform is the MH-60S helicopter; greater than 40 W average power of 532nm at 350 Hz, 6ns pulsewidth; fully qualified against MIL-STD-810F, MIL-STD-704E, and MIL-STD-461E in both storage and operational scenarios; input power is three-phase, 400 Hz, 115 VAC

AQS-20 – Used to detect, localize, and classify bottom, and volume mines; platform is an underwater towed body tethered to the MH-53E helicopter, MH-60S helicopter, or Remote Minehunting System (RMS); short pulsewidth, conductively-cooled, 532nm laser operating at 400 Hz; total power draw is less than
400 W

SHOALS (Scanning Hydrographic Operational Airborne Lidar Survey) – Bathymetric lidar for rapidly measuring shallow water depths and near shore land elevations; deployed on Bell 212 helicopter and Dehaviland Twin Otter airplane; three generations of lasers were built operating at 200 Hz, 400 Hz, and 1 KHz respectively; laser output both 532nm and 1064nm

CHARTS (Compact Hydrographic Airborne Rapid Total Survey) – 3 KHz version of the SHOALS laser

Space Lasers

Delta Star 183

Brilliant Pebbles

MOLA (Mars Observer Laser Altimeter) – Diode-pumped Nd:YAG slab laser; laser output is 40mj at 10 Hz with a 10ns pulsewidth; the laser consumed less than 15 W from 28 VDC input power; housed in an all beryllium enclosure; conductively cooled

Clementine – Diode-pumped Nd:YAG laser operated at 1064nm and 532nm; pulse energy of 180mj with a 10ns pulsewidth; fired at 1 Hz continuously or an 8 Hz burst mode up to 400 pulses

NEAR (Near Earth Asteroid Rendezvous) – Diode-pumped Cr;Nd:YAG laser operated at 1064nm; output energy is 15mj with a 15ns pulsewidth; firing rate was selectable between 1/8, 1, 2, and 8 Hz
